Meet KyJuan!

REC Coordinators are vital to Urban Initiatives’ mission of empowering Chicago’s youth to become agents of community change through academic success, healthy living, and leadership development. They drive systematic change by connecting stakeholders and strengthening the social fabric of the community. Meet KyJuan, one of UI’s newest REC Coordinators!
